Least Common Multiple of 62892 and 62911 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 62892 and 62911,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(62892,62911) = 1
LCM(62892,62911) = ( 62892 × 62911) / 1
LCM(62892,62911) = 3956598612 / 1
LCM(62892,62911) = 3956598612
